Robot Fest is a free 1-day event for students of all ages and for those with the unquenchable urge to create new, previously unseen forms from lifeless electronics and mechanical parts of metal and plastic.  Starting 8 years ago we focused on the demonstration of robotic projects, but more recently we have expanded into realms where technology is used in any creative fashion. We want to encompass the hackers, hobbyists and makers and those who are not content to sit back and watch yet another screen, be it on a phone, handheld, laptop, desktop or wall-mounted flat-panel.  If you are inexplicably drawn to sites like makezine.com, hackaday.com and instructables.com, please come on by.
